Output f106ed8c58d813f7c7c17eeea8bc500e6cf5426dccd9418c2c0c1fce09a649ad:0

value
532937271
script pubkey
OP_0 OP_PUSHBYTES_20 d69d1f3c86a48bfe1f4317e7bb2d8e0184cf0b8b
address
bc1q66w370yx5j9lu86rzlnmktvwqxzv7zutkdyr03
transaction
f106ed8c58d813f7c7c17eeea8bc500e6cf5426dccd9418c2c0c1fce09a649ad